> Hi all,
>
> I would like to describe the following problem to you and hope that you 
> can
> help me.
>
> I am using JAWS 7.10 and Internet Explorer 7 on my Computer under Windows
> XP. The reason why I am still using these old versions of both JAWS and 
> the
> Internet Explorer is because they seem very reliable--well, they seemed 
> very
> reliable, but now things have changed. Lately, I have had problems with 
> this
> computer. When I now open the Internet Explorer, I can only see the line:
> "Google homepage", but nothing happens when I press arrow-up or 
> arrow-down.
> My boy-friend, however, who is sighted and therefore using the same 
> computer
> with the mouse, can still work with the Internet Explorer and nothing has
> changed for him. With STRG+O I can go to "open" and enter a website 
> address,
> and by pressing enter I get to this page, but I will again only see the 
> top
> of the page and won't be able to navigate.
>
> I have already tried to fix the JAWS version, but it has not have any 
> effect
> on the problem.
>
> Any ideas?
